**Ticket: ImageVault cache config drift**

Welcome to the team — fun first ticket! The ImageVault thumbnail cache on prod-east has been leaking memory for a week, and it turns out someone bumped the eviction settings by hand during the Fennridge outage and never backported the change. I dumped what the live node is actually running.

config for tajof-kawep:
[aldius]
port = 3000
region = lower-2
host = aldius.plorvasoft.example
team = eliius
timeout_ms = 750
retries = 6

## Offline Mode — FieldTrace Survey

When connectivity drops, FieldTrace queues survey submissions in the local SQLite spool and retries on a backoff timer. Reviewers: confirm the spool cap is enforced before merge — unbounded growth bricked two tablets during the Harkness Valley pilot. Sync resumes automatically once the beacon endpoint responds twice within the health window. Do not change flush ordering; dedupe depends on it. Verify the client build reads these values at startup, not per-sync. The current offline configuration is as follows.

settings of hadup-kajop:
HOLATH_PIN=1733
HOLATH_METRICS_HOST=metrics.holath.qirvanworks.corp
HOLATH_LOG_LEVEL=error
HOLATH_TENANT=belael

Prepared for the incoming director. Demand for the Tarnic valve series exceeds current line output by roughly 22%. Options assessed: third shift at Halveston, or expansion of the Quillbrook site. Quillbrook expansion carries higher capital cost but lower unit cost at scale; payback estimated at four years. Third shift viable within one quarter but strains maintenance windows. Finance recommends Quillbrook, contingent on board approval next cycle. The confidential summary of associated business plans appears immediately below.

internal memo for yahag-tahog: The pricing group signed off on a budget of $152.8 million for Project Soriel.

## SQL Lint Gate — Quillbase CI

All `.sql` files in the Quillbase repo pass through sqlfence before merge. Rules: no `SELECT *`, no dynamic string concatenation in WHERE clauses, mandatory parameterized inputs, and no grants to PUBLIC. Violations block the pipeline; overrides require a signed waiver from the Marrowgate review board. The linter itself runs as a service job and reports findings to the Vexley audit endpoint. To reproduce a lint run locally, authenticate against the audit endpoint using the key below.

API key for yahig-tadup: kto7_ubizbYm